rprivacy megathread is a community-driven thread on Reddit, where users share and discuss various methods and tools for maintaining online anonymity and privacy. The thread, which has gained significant traction in recent years, serves as a centralized hub for individuals seeking to protect their online identity and shield themselves from surveillance.

While not directly in the privacy section, other tools and guides found within the broader community complement the "rprivacy megathread." For instance, tools like are extensions that allow you to take control of your own Reddit history. Redust can "anonymize, overwrite and/or delete all your reddit comments and posts," helping you manage your digital footprint on the platform itself. These kinds of tools are essential for anyone who wants to maintain privacy over the long term.
